Explanation:
Aeration is the process of bringing water into contact with air. This physical interaction allows gases to transfer between the two phases—most importantly, it adds oxygen to the water and can help remove dissolved gases and volatile compounds. In practice, aeration is used to boost dissolved oxygen for treatment and to improve taste, odor, and odor-related contaminants, as well as to aid in oxidizing certain dissolved metals by increasing contact with air. Aeration is achieved through methods that maximize surface area and turbulence, such as diffusers emitting air bubbles, splash or cascade systems, or spraying water to increase air exposure. This differs from filtration, which removes solids by passing water through a barrier; oxidation, which is a chemical reaction adding oxygen (not just contact with air); and sedimentation, which relies on gravity to settle suspended solids.
